Supporters' Club Question The Board
[Friday 9 May 2008 14:50:53]
In the wake of last weekend's events in Cardiff, the supporters' club have issued an open letter to the club's board of directors. Posted on their website as well as the forums and sent to various publications it states "This season has turned out to be the most disappointing for many years. With the exception of two games there has been a distinct lack of pride, passion and commitment, both on and off the pitch. The Board of Directors has a responsibility to the army of loyal supporters who feel bitterly demoralised and embarrassed by the current performance of the club." Follow the link for the statement in full. The next event for the club this this coming Tuesday 13th May when members will get the chance to quiz Terry Matterson. The event is at The Loft, Xscape. Membership is available on the night.

Juniors Win Again
[Friday 9 May 2008 08:37:11]
One ray of light at the moment is the form of the Tigers' academy side. Last night they recorded their 4th win in 5 games this season with a 42-26 win at Hull KR. The win came thanks to a superb second half show, the side were losing 16-6 at the turnaround but 36 second half points meant we returned home with the spoils. Sam Lynch and Josh Atkinson both scored twice while points machine Joe Arundel added another 7 goals to his tally for the season. Follow the link to see the full team from this game or click here for all the details from the season so far.

FC Sign Maloney
[Thursday 8 May 2008 10:00:43]
A day of news for former Tigers: former academy prop Dom Maloney has been announced as Hull FC's first capture for the 2009 season. Maloney has starred for Dewsbury for the past two seasons and now has the chance to make the step up into Superleague. Maloney made 2 appearances for Cas under Dave Woods during our first stint in the National Leagues.

Raper Moves Into Coaching Ranks
[Thursday 8 May 2008 08:17:57]
The Illawarra Mercury reports that former Tiger Aaron Raper is moving into coaching having taken the head coaching position at Wollongong Bulls. Former team mate Dale Fritz will be the Bulls' fitness co-ordinator. Raper told the paper: "It's all happened pretty quick and I'm relishing the chance to coach in the Illawarra competition, which I've heard is a strong one. I'm new to it but we'll get a good indication of how things stand on Saturday."
Terry Looking To Start Again
[Thursday 8 May 2008 08:09:22]
Terry Matterson has told the Ponte & Cas that Cas need to forget what has gone on and start their season again. "I think in a way we need to start our season now," he said. "We've done some good things in the first half of the season but didn't win enough games. It's time to draw a line in the sand and move forward. I've still got confidence in them because I've seen what we can do. Two weeks is a long time in rugby league and I've no doubt that we can turn it around."
